Experience the ultimate thrill of leaping from dizzying heights. Queenstown is home to the world's first commercial bungee site and offers various heights and styles of jumps.
Feel the spray and the speed as you navigate pristine rivers. Jet boats offer high-speed spins and thrills through narrow canyons, while rafting provides an exhilarating ride down challenging rapids.
Descend waterfalls, slide down natural rock slides, and rappel down cliff faces in stunning canyon environments. These tours combine trekking with thrilling descents.
Explore the scenic trails surrounding Queenstown on two wheels or soar through the canopy on exhilarating zipline courses. Perfect for those who enjoy exploring at a faster pace.
Tours typically range from 2-4 hours for single activities like jet boating or bungee, with full-day options available for combinations like rafting and canyoning.
Queenstown experiences four distinct seasons. Adventure activities generally operate year-round, but be prepared for cooler temperatures in winter and potential rain at any time. Tours often run in most weather conditions.
Group sizes vary. Jet boats often carry multiple passengers, while bungee jumps are individual. Canyoning and rafting tours can range from small, intimate groups to larger parties.
Often includes transport to the activity site, necessary safety equipment (helmets, harnesses, life jackets), and professional guides. Some full-day packages might include lunch.
Most tours have a designated meeting point in Queenstown town center, usually at the operator's office or a central pickup location. Some may offer hotel pickups.
Prices vary significantly. Bungee jumps can start around $200 USD, while jet boating tours are typically $70-$100 USD. Whitewater rafting and canyoning can range from $150-$300 USD.
Book in advance, especially during peak season (December-February) and school holidays, as popular tours sell out quickly.
Check the age, weight, and health restrictions for each activity before booking. Some activities have strict limitations.
Wear comfortable, weather-appropriate clothing and sturdy, closed-toe shoes. You'll likely be provided with specialized gear.
Bring a waterproof camera or ensure your phone has a secure waterproof case if you want to capture the action – but be aware some operators restrict personal cameras for safety.
Consider purchasing an 'adventure pass' or multi-activity bundle if you plan on doing several different thrill-seeking experiences; these often offer good value.
Listen carefully to all safety briefings from your guides. Their instructions are crucial for a safe and enjoyable experience.
Factor in travel time to and from your activity, especially if it's located outside of Queenstown town center.

A: Absolutely! Queenstown offers a fantastic range of activities suitable for beginners. Many jet boat rides, scenic zipline tours, and even some introductory rafting trips are designed for those new to adventure sports.
A: While Queenstown adventure sports operate year-round, summer (December-February) offers the warmest weather and longest daylight hours. However, spring (September-November) and autumn (March-May) provide stunning scenery with fewer crowds and often pleasant conditions.
A: It depends on the activity. While some high-octane pursuits require a reasonable level of fitness, many iconic Queenstown experiences like jet boating or bungee jumping have minimal physical demands beyond what's required to get to the jump/ride point. Always check specific activity requirements.
A: Yes, many operators offer package deals or multi-adventure passes that combine several activities, often at a discounted rate. You can explore these options when comparing tours on TopTours.ai.
A: Most adventure sports operators in Queenstown are experienced in dealing with varied weather. Many tours run in light rain or wind. If conditions are deemed unsafe, the operator will usually offer to reschedule your tour or provide a refund.
A: Definitely! Many visitors combine a morning bungee jump with an afternoon jet boat ride, or a whitewater rafting trip with a scenic zipline. It's a popular way to maximize your adventure time in Queenstown.
A: You'll need to wear comfortable clothing that allows for movement and sturdy, closed-toe shoes. The operator will provide you with a secure harness that goes over your clothes.
